Troubleshooting Plastic Endcaps That Won't Stay In Place On Rhino-Rack Vortex Crossbars
Question:
After locking the endcaps, I can just pull them off. This cant be right as it defeats the security. I am also concerned they may fall out or be pulled out by the aerodynamics. It seems that I am seating the endcaps but it looks to me that the clasp on the lock is not engaging the slot on the bar. Any suggestions on what I should do? Thanks. PS. These are Vortex crossbars VA126B
asked by: Andrew G
Expert Reply:
Regarding the endcaps popping out on your Rhino-Rack Vortex Aero Crossbars - 49" # RRVA126B-2, this is not a common occurrence and I have not heard of this happening before. Make sure the rubber strip, or anything else for that matter, is not getting caught between the crossbar and endcap. Then make sure you are fully pushing the plastic endcaps into place and locking them all the way with the included key. If you are still having issues then let me know and we can dig deeper into the issues you are having.
I also recommend upgrading to the metal lock endcaps: Rhino-Rack Locking Endcaps for Vortex Aero Crossbars - Metal Cores - Qty 4 # RRVA-LEC4. This will do a better job of keeping channel-mounted accessories safe and secured and tend to hold up better than the included plastic locks.
